🌼Crush Calling: In the realm of K-POP stans, referring to your favorite idol or bias as a "crush" just doesn't cut it. Instead, prepare to embrace a whole new level of affectionate nicknames. From "bias" to "oppa" (used by female fans for older male idols), "unnie" (used by female fans for older female idols), and "maknae" (the youngest member of a group), these endearing terms add an extra layer of familiarity and adoration to the fan-idol relationship.

🌼Fan Chants and Beyond:
At a K-POP concert, fan chants are a vital part of the experience. As a stan, you'll find yourself immersed in the art of synchronizing your voice with hundreds or even thousands of others, creating a powerful wave of support for your favorite group. Fan chants are not just a display of unity; they are a tangible expression of love and encouragement.

🌼The Power of Fan Projects:
K-POP stans are known for their creativity and dedication to supporting their idols. Fan projects range from organizing charity fundraisers in the name of idols to creating elaborate fan art and videos. These acts of appreciation demonstrate the deep emotional connection between stans and their beloved artists, showcasing a level of commitment rarely seen in other music fandoms.

🌼Dance Cover Fever: Who needs Dance Dance Revolution when you have K-POP dance covers? Being a K-POP stan often means attempting to master the intricate choreography of your favorite songs. You'll find yourself spending hours perfecting the moves, joining dance cover groups, and sharing your performances online for fellow stans to appreciate. It's a fun and energetic way to express your love for the music and connect with other fans.

🌼Unparalleled Dedication: K-POP stans are a force to be reckoned with when it comes to supporting their idols. From streaming music videos and songs on repeat to voting in countless polls and awards, their dedication knows no bounds. The passion exhibited by K-POP stans sets them apart, showcasing a level of commitment and loyalty that extends far beyond merely being a casual listener.

🌼Language and Cultural Appreciation: One significant aspect of being a K-POP stan is the exposure to Korean language and culture. Stans often find themselves naturally picking up Korean phrases, exploring traditional customs, and delving into the vibrant world of Korean entertainment beyond just the music. K-POP becomes a gateway to a rich cultural experience that expands horizons and fosters appreciation for diversity.

🌼The Fandom Family: Being a K-POP stan means becoming part of a global family. From bonding over shared interests on online forums to attending fan gatherings and concerts, the sense of belonging is unparalleled. The fandom becomes a safe space where stans can freely express their love for their idols without fear of judgment

🌼Fan Terminology: K-POP stans use specific terminology that is exclusive to the fandom. For example, they refer to their favorite idol or bias using terms like "bias," "oppa" (used by female fans for older male idols), "unnie" (used by female fans for older female idols), or "maknae" (referring to the youngest member of a group). These terms reflect the fans' affectionate and personal connection to the idols.
